A car was totaled early on the morning of May 5 at the intersection of Highland Street and Southern Avenue when the vehicle got stuck on the tracks and then was hit by an oncoming train.

The car was owned by University of Memphis student Angela Clark, who said her car was totaled in the incident.

“I’ve already got my ticket. I just want to get my keys so I can go home,” Clark said.

Clark said she was driving through the intersection at about 2 a.m. that Sunday morning when her car tires got stuck on the railroad tracks.

“My car got stuck five minutes before the train came," Clark said.

Creative Stitches, located at 3525 Mynders Ave., was envisioned by owner Grapple Woodward 20 years ago.  Stacy Simmons, office manager says Creative Stitches is known for its Greek attire, personal embroideries, baby apparel and cosmetic bags. In addition, Simmons says there are two sides to the store. The retail side, where customers purchase items, and the commercial side, where companies are given the option to order wholesale clothing with imprinted logos. The company website is stitchestogo.com and store hours are Monday-Thursday 9 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. and Friday 9 a.m. to 5 p.m.
